BlueCity Announces Third Quarter 2020 Unaudited Financial Results

47.3% year-over-year revenue growth
43.8% year-over-year total paying user growth
–Reported first quarterly adjusted net income of RMB7.1 million (US$1.0 million)
Completed acquisition of Finka, a leading Chinese gay social networking app
BEIJING, Dec. 02,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— BlueCity Holdings Limited (“BlueCity” or the “Company”) (Nasdaq: BLCT), a leading online LGBTQ platform, today announced its unaudited financial results for the third quarter ended September 30, 2020.Third Quarter 2020 HighlightsTotal revenues reached RMB297.6 million (US$43.8 million), an increase of 47.3% from the same period in 2019.Net loss was RMB137.8 million (US$20.3 million), compared with net loss of RMB7.1 million in the third quarter of 2019.Adjusted Net Income1(Non-GAAP) was RMB7.1 million (US$1.0 million), compared with adjusted net loss (non-GAAP) of RMB6.5 million in the third quarter of 2019.Monthly active users (“MAUs”) on the Blued mobile app reached 6.3 million, an increase of 7.0% from the same period in 2019.Total paying users2 on the Blued mobile app reached 494 thousand, an increase of 43.8% compared with 344 thousand in the third quarter of 2019.“In the third quarter we devoted resources to optimizing our service and product offering and identified opportunities to accelerate our global expansion.” Said Mr. Baoli Ma, BlueCity’s Founder,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er. “This includes: the promotion of marketing campaigns and introduction of an all-new “Community” feature to the China version of the Blued app to foster a greater sense of community, and the launch of a new version of the LESDO app. Furthermore, we have introduced major updates tailored for local users to the Blued app in Latin America. We believe our continued efforts in product innovation and global expansion will broaden our user community and further improve our presence and brand awareness internationally.”Mr. Ma continued: “In addition to our strong organic business growth this quarter, on November 25, we announced the acquisition of Finka, a leading gay social-networking app for a younger generation in China, to further develop our portfolio of apps and services designed to help members across geographies and demographics. Today, we are pleased to announce that the transaction has been successfully closed. Targeting a younger generation, Finka complements our Blued app both in functionality and in users’ demographics. We look forward to building a better future for our community.”Mr. Zhiyong (Ben) Li, BlueCity’s Chief Financial Officer commented: “We had another strong quarter in which we generated solid operational and financial results. Total revenue grew 47.3% year-over-year to RMB297.6 million, and we achieved positive adjusted net income for the first time. These results demonstrate both the strength of our strategy and our ability to execute. Looking ahead, we will continue to drive growth through rapid expansion into the key markets and subgroups within the LGBTQ community.”Third Quarter 2020 Financial ResultsTotal RevenuesTotal revenues were RMB297.6 million (US$43.8 million), representing an increase of 47.3% year-over-year.Live streaming services. Revenues from live streaming services reached RMB255.2 million (US$37.6 million), representing an increase of 42.9% from the same period of 2019. The increase was primarily due to growth of the Company’s live streaming services in China and globally, as well as the increase in the Company’s paying users for live streaming services.Membership services. Revenues from membership services reached RMB18.2 million (US$2.7 million), representing an increase of 56.4% from the same period of 2019. The increase was primarily due to the rapid development of the Company’s membership services offerings.Advertising services. Revenues from advertising services reached RMB10.1 million (US$1.5 million), representing an increase of 38.8% from the same period of 2019.Others. Revenues from other services and merchandise sales reached RMB14.1 million (US$2.1 million), compared with RMB4.5 million from the third quarter of 2019. The increase was mainly attributable to the growth of the Company’s sales of merchandise.Total cost and expensesCost of revenues. The cost of revenues was RMB201.6 million (US$29.7 million), representing an increase of 41.3% year-over-year. The increase was primarily due to the growth of revenue-sharing costs along with the continued growth of live streaming services, as well as the share-based compensation expenses with the Company’s initial public offering (the “IPO”) condition.Selling and marketing expenses. Selling and marketing expenses were RMB58.0 million (US$8.5 million), representing an increase of 86.3% year-over-year. The increase was mainly due to the increased advertising and promotion expenses and staff cost, as well as the share-based compensation expenses with the IPO condition.Technology and development expenses. Technology and development expenses were RMB50.3 million (US$7.4 million), representing an increase of 49.5% year-over-year. The increase was mainly due to the share-based compensation expenses with the IPO condition.General and administration expenses. General and administrative expenses were RMB132.4 million (US$19.5 million), representing an increase of 4349% year-over-year. The increase was mainly due to professional service fees incurred for the IPO and the share-based compensation expenses with the IPO condition.Operating lossOperating loss was RMB144.7 million (US$21.3 million), compared with a loss of RMB8.4 million in the third quarter of 2019.Income tax (benefit)/expenseIncome tax expense were RMB1.0 million (US$0.2 million), compared with income tax benefit amounted to RMB29 thousand in the third quarter of 2019.Net lossNet loss was RMB137.8 million (US$20.3 million), compared with net loss of RMB7.1 million in the third quarter of 2019.Adjusted net income/loss (Non-GAAP) 3Adjusted net income was RMB7.1 million (US$1.0 million) compared with adjusted net loss of RMB6.5 million in the third quarter of 2019. Adjusted net margin was 2.4%, compared with adjusted net loss margin of 3.2% in the third quarter of 2019.Cash and cash equivalents and term depositsAs of September 30, 2020, the Company had cash and cash equivalents and term deposits of RMB836.5 million (US$123.2 million), compared to RMB380.3 million as of December 31, 2019. The increase was mainly due to the net proceeds received from the IPO.Business OutlookFor the fourth quarter of 2020, the Company expects total revenues to be between RMB277 million to RMB297 million, representing year-over-year growth of 24% to 33%. To access the replay, please reference the conference ID 3483656.A live and archived webcast of the conference call will be available on the company’s investors relations website at https://ir.blue-city.com/.About BlueCityBlueCity (NASDAQ: BLCT) is a world-leading online LGBTQ platform providing a full suite of services that foster connections and enhance the wellbeing of the LGBTQ community through its portfolio of brands. BlueCity’s mobile app Blued enables users to conveniently and safely connect with each other, express themselves and access professional health-related and family planning consulting services. Available in 13 languages, it has more than 58 million registered users worldwide and is the largest online LGBTQ community in China, India, Korea, Thailand and Vietnam. BlueCity’s portfolio of brands also includes Finka, a leading gay social networking app for a younger generation in China, and LESDO, a leading lesbian social networking app in China.Use of Non-GAAP Financial MeasuresThe Company uses non-GAAP measures, such as adjusted net loss, in evaluating its operating results and for financial and operational decision-making purposes.
